The black gate was only about a dozen meters high.

Lin Sheng moved slowly and warily, breathing softly while listening to the sounds around him.

*Thump...*

Suddenly, there was a dull sound like that of a bell, coming from Blackfeather City.

Lin Sheng stopped at once.

*Thump... Thump... Thump...*

The thuds rang on for five consecutive times before they died off. freewe bnovel .com

Lin Sheng stood still, listening carefully to the changes around him.

After a few minutes, nothing happened. He raised his sword again and gradually moved forward.

Soon he passed through the gate again, and the view ahead was clear.

It was filled with decaying blackened buildings and streets. Unknown pieces of black rags drifted in the wind while a lone direction sign stood by the side of the road.

Lin Sheng did not approach the direction sign but went straight to the right side of the street without hesitation.

He felt some roughness as he stepped on the street’s hard gravel.

On the right side of the street, the main road was paved with rough cobblestone and flanked by broken black stone buildings that looked like they had been burned.

Most of these buildings were two or three stories high. They did not look like shops but more like ordinary houses or cottages.

Stone lamp posts stood at intervals on the main road.

To Lin Sheng’s surprise, the lamp posts were actually emitting a pale yellow light. Within their square lampshades, the candle flames flickered in the cold wind.

“But it wasn’t like this before...”He recalled what the street looked like the last time he was there. The lamps were not lit at that time.

Feeling like something was amiss, Lin Sheng quickly looked for a place to hide.

Glancing around, he soon found a row of buildings on the right with holes in its broken windows and doors. He could easily get in and hide there for a while.

However, those holes frightened him just as much. Who knew what dangers lurked inside?

There was nothing else on the empty and deserted street.

“I’ll wake up if I don’t go on...” Lin Sheng summoned up his courage and took his sword. He followed the planned route, walking forward.

*Tap... Tap...*

Though he tried to tread as softly as he could, his footsteps still echoed across the street.

*Hiss...*

Suddenly, a slight noise came from the front as if someone was whispering in his ear.

Lin Sheng quickly found a broken window and got in.

He proceeded to crouch down and hide behind a wall.

*Hiss... Hiss...*

The sound was closing in...

In the middle of the street, a huge shadow of two stories tall was leisurely wriggling its way through the neighborhood, its long tail trailing behind.

Countless ant-like black insects were crawling all over the huge shadow. Lin Sheng could not see its face clearly as it was completely covered by the black insects.

Nevertheless, beyond the insects, Lin Sheng saw a human silhouette on the upper part of the huge shadow.

The creature was flicking its forked tongue, and the three pairs of black eyes on its face looked like holes in a rotten tree.

Its eyes were now scanning around greedily.

Lin Sheng slowly and silently peeped through the crack in the window.

He swallowed hard and dared not move.

The monster wriggled past him quickly. It possessed the form of a human on top and that of a python at the bottom, and its long, thick tail was covered with smooth black scales.

The cobblestone on the street rubbed against its scales, creating the hissing sound that Lin Sheng had just heard.

Some of the pieces of debris in front of the monster were easily crushed by it.

Lin Sheng dared not make a sound.

Once you were targeted by a monster of this size, it was hard to escape.

The hissing faded away, but Lin Sheng was too afraid to budge.

The size of the monster frightened him. Once you were discovered by such a monster, you would have no chance of survival.

He did not get up until the hissing was completely gone for quite some time.

“Young man... have you seen my Justin?”

Suddenly, a trepidatious female voice traveled from behind Lin Sheng.

Lin Sheng was startled. He immediately stood up and turned around, raising his sword to strike.

That was when he found himself in a shabby living room.

At one corner of the room, in a doorway leading to the other room, a pale woman was standing there.

The woman seemed to be in her forties, appearing haggard and anxious.

Her eyes were sunken with dark circles and heavy bags under them. She was wearing a gray cloak, similar to that of a nun’s, and it covered her head.

“Young man... have you seen my Justin?” the woman repeated.

Lin Sheng was alert, but he was relieved. It was the first time he had met anyone who could speak in his dreams, and it gave him a faint sense of security.

He had remained alone for too long in that deathly stillness, which made him feel a little on edge, but he finally met someone to communicate with.

Lin Sheng narrowed his eyes, making sure that there was no obvious hidden weapon in the woman’s hands before he moved a little closer.

“Hi, I don’t know who you’re talking about. But if you can give me some clues, perhaps I can help you find him.”

He answered slowly and clearly, in the same Blackfeather City accent.

The language used in his dream world was Ancient Rehn, which he got from the memory fragments. At first, he felt a little awkward speaking the language, but he quickly became proficient.

The woman’s focus now fell entirely on Lin Sheng.

“Are you sure you can help me find him?”

“If you can provide me some clues and help,” Lin Sheng replied cautiously.

“Can you find Justin if I help you?”

“I think so, maybe, maybe...”

“When? When can you find him? Now! Now! All right!! I need to find Justin now, now!!! Now!!! Now!!!” The woman was going berserk and getting closer.

She started to flail her arms wildly, her eyes turning redder and redder.

All of a sudden, her head exploded!

The woman’s head exploded like a balloon.

A stream of sand-like black fluid spewed forth from the explosion. The fluid gathered in black lines on the ground, hissing softly, and the next moment, the fluid sped toward him.

Thick masses of black lines filled the room in an instant, rushing madly at him from all directions.

“F*ck!” Lin Sheng did not have time to think. He turned around and jumped out of the window.

The next second, countless black lines rushed frantically out of the window, chasing him.

Lin Sheng fell over and rolled on the ground. When he looked back, his face turned pale. He instantly got up and ran for his life.
